Secretarial and related occupations vs Typists and related keyboard occupations Salary

How do Secretarial and related occupations and Typists and related keyboard occupations sal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own using the latest ONS data.

Typists and related keyboard occupations earns £1,377 more per year (6% higher)

Secretarial and related occupations

£22,255
per year (gross)
Take-home: £19,543
vs

Typists and related keyboard occupations

£23,632
per year (gross)
Take-home: £20,535

Detailed Comparison

MetricSecretarial and related occupationsTypists and related keyboard occupationsDifference
Median Annual£22,255£23,632-£1,377
Mean Annual£23,001£23,653-£652
Take-Home (Net)£19,543£20,535-£992
Monthly (Gross)£1,855£1,969-£114
Weekly (Gross)£428£454-£26
Hourly£10.70£11.36-£0.66
